Kingsmead Leisure Centre, Canterbury

Modus acted as Quantity Surveyor for Active Life Ltd on an impressive transformation project at Kingsmead Leisure Centre in Canterbury. The works saw a centre previously becoming dilapidated, being given a new life for its local community and now includes three new fitness suites, a health suite and a large gym. Completed in September 2024, the project has taken 18 months.

The project also encompassed improvements to the swimming pool and sports hall, a new café area and extended car parking for visitors. Works have been funded through various sources including Canterbury City Council, green energy funding, namely PSDS (Public Sector Decarbonisation Scheme) via Salix, and government funding for a state-of-the-art accessible changing place.

The Kingsmead’s handover sees the completion of a series of three leisure centre projects with Active Life Ltd. in the Canterbury area (Herons, Whitstable & Kingsmead).

Key successes of the project included management of the afore mentioned funding pots, as well as keeping the swimming pool open for public use throughout by way of creating a temporary changing facility.

Several challenges were also encountered, including asbestos removal, contaminated soil removal and staged beneficial occupation to allow leisure centre staff to fit out the centre and begin training on the operation of the centre.
